SRINAGAR: Police have arrested a Kashmir University student and booked him under UAPA. The case against him was registered in 2018.

Aaqib Malik

Identified as Aaqib Ahmed Malik son of Mushtaq Ahmed Malik, a resident of Aglar Pinjora area of South Kashmir’s Shopian district, reports appearing in the media said he was summoned by police for questioning and arrested.

“A case vide number 68/2018 under section 13 of Unlawful Activities Act stands registered at Police Station Nigeen. The role of the student has been established and subsequently, he has been detained,” a local news gatherer KNT quoted police sources as saying.

Aaqib, reports said was a student activist. Another report quoting another police official saying: “He was booked for his alleged active participation in anti-national activities in the university campus and dent image of law enforcing agencies besides causing disaffection against the country.”

Interestingly, Aaqib was earlier arrested in February 2020 under preventive detention act 107/151 and was detained in Central Jail Srinagar for around eight days. He was released and later asked to avoid attending classes for almost a month. Aaqib is pursuing masters in biochemistry since 2017.
